Presentations of the braid group of the complex reflection group G(d,d,n)$G(d,d,n)$

open access: yesJournal of the London Mathematical Society, Volume 113, Issue 4, April 2026.
Abstract We show that the braid group associated to the complex reflection group G(d,d,n)$G(d,d,n)$ is an index d$d$ subgroup of the braid group of the orbifold quotient of the complex numbers by a cyclic group of order d$d$. We also give a compatible presentation of G(d,d,n)$G(d,d,n)$ and its braid group for each tagged triangulation of the disk with ...

Noncommutative polygonal cluster algebras

open access: yesJournal of the London Mathematical Society, Volume 113, Issue 4, April 2026.
Abstract We define a new family of noncommutative generalizations of cluster algebras called polygonal cluster algebras. These algebras generalize the noncommutative surfaces of Berenstein–Retakh, and are inspired by the emerging theory of Θ$\Theta$‐positivity for the groups Spin(p,q)$\mathrm{Spin}(p,q)$.

Simplification of exponential factors of irregular connections on P1${\mathbb {P}}^1$

open access: yesBulletin of the London Mathematical Society, Volume 58, Issue 3, March 2026.
Abstract We give an explicit algorithm to reduce the ramification order of any exponential factor of an irregular connection on P1$\mathbb {P}^1$, using the same types of basic operations as in the Katz–Deligne–Arinkin algorithm for rigid irregular connections.
